How do I connect to a remote server using SSH?
How to Connect via SSH
- Open the SSH terminal on your machine and run the following command: ssh your_username@host_ip_address. ...
- Type in your password and hit Enter. ...
- When you are connecting to a server for the very first time, it will ask you if you want to continue connecting.
How do I SSH into a Ubuntu server?
Enabling SSH on Ubuntu
- Open your terminal either by using the Ctrl+Alt+T keyboard shortcut or by clicking on the terminal icon and install the openssh-server package by typing: sudo apt update sudo apt install openssh-server. ...
- Once the installation is completed, the SSH service will start automatically.
